Anyway, I went on walking home, thinking about the movie, and then suddenly wishing I had some company. Greasers can't walk alone too much or they'll get jumped, or someone will come by and scream "Greaser!" at them, which doesn't make you feel too hot, if you know what I mean. We get jumped by the Socs. I'm not sure how you spell it, but it's the abbreviation for the Socials, the jet set, the West-side rich kids. It's like the term "greaser," which is used to class all us boys on the East Side.

—The Outsiders,
S.E. Hinton

Listen to "El Manisero" by the Havana Casino Orchestra under the leadership of Justo "Don" Azpiazu. On what instrument is the song's distinctive repeated syncopated pattern of five strokes over a regular eight-beat pulse played?

Answers

The claves is a pair of cylindrical hardwood sticks about 8 inches long and one inch in diameter, one of which is held in the player's fingertips over the cupped hand. Hence, the pattern is played on a percussion instrument called the claves and contains five beats, or strokes.

Havana Casino Orchestra

Justo Ángel Azpiazú also known as Don Azpiazú, was a leading Cuban orchestral director in the 1920s and 1930s. His group introduced authentic Cuban dance music and Cuban musical instruments to the USA. It was his Havana Casino Orchestra which went to New York City in 1930. It was arguably the biggest hits in Cuban music history, titled "Peanut Vendor".

Therefore, the instrument the song's repeated syncopated pattern of five strokes over was the clave.

state three ways in which an unhealthy living environment could negatively affect the quality of life of people living in the environment ​

Answers

1. Health problems: An unhealthy living environment can cause several health problems, such as respiratory diseases, skin infections, infections from contaminated water or food, etc. These health problems can make it difficult for people to carry out their day-to-day activities, and negatively impact their quality of life.

2. Safety concerns: An unhealthy living environment can also pose safety concerns for people living in the environment. For example, living in areas with high levels of pollution or near hazardous waste sites can increase the risk of chemical exposure, which can have long-term health effects. Additionally, living in areas with poor sanitation or inadequate housing can increase the risk of accidents and injuries.

3. Social isolation: Living in an unhealthy environment can also lead to social isolation. For example, if people are concerned about the safety of their neighborhood or the quality of their water supply, they may avoid socializing with others or participating in community events. This can lead to feelings of loneliness and isolation, which can negatively impact mental health and overall quality of life.

Andy Warhol's 1963 work titled "Race Riot" shows that the artist is most interested in which traditional role?

Answers

Andy Warhol's usual function in his work "Race Riot" is that of a social commentator or critic, utilizing art to confront important issues and generate thinking and conversation about them.

What was Warhol's "Race Riot about?

Andy Warhol's 1963 work named "Race Riot" was devised all along the climax of the Civil Rights Movement in the United States. The canvas describes a photograph of a powerful clash middle from two points lawman and protesters all the while a civil liberties expression in Birmingham, Alabama.

Through "Race Riot," Warhol was commenting on the extensive and determined apartheid in American society and the barbarism used to restrain the civil liberties motion. The work shows Warhol's interest in utilizing creativity by way of of public and governmental analysis, a part that many existing inventors were opposing in the 1960s.

Read the following passage from Anne of Green Gables by Lucy Maud Montgomery. Answer the question that follows the text.

"Marilla, can I go over to see Diana just for a minute?" asked Anne, running breathlessly down from the east gable one February evening.

"I don't see what you want to be traipsing about after dark for," said Marilla shortly. "You and Diana walked home from school together and then stood down there in the snow for half an hour more, your tongues going the whole blessed time, clickety-clack. So I don't think you're very badly off to see her again."

"But she wants to see me," pleaded Anne. "She has something very important to tell me."

"How do you know she has?"

"Because she just signaled to me from her window. We have arranged a way to signal with our candles and cardboard. We set the candle on the window sill and make flashes by passing the cardboard back and forth. So many flashes mean a certain thing. It was my idea, Marilla."

"I'll warrant you it was," said Marilla emphatically. "And the next thing you'll be setting fire to the curtains with your signaling nonsense."

"Oh, we're very careful, Marilla. And it's so interesting. Two flashes mean, `Are you there?' Three mean `yes' and four `no.' Five mean, `Come over as soon as possible, because I have something important to reveal.' Diana has just signaled five flashes, and I'm really suffering to know what it is."

"Well, you needn't suffer any longer," said Marilla sarcastically. "You can go, but you're to be back here in just ten minutes, remember that."

Anne did remember it and was back in the stipulated time, although probably no mortal will ever know just what it cost her to confine the discussion of Diana's important communication within the limits of ten minutes. But at least she had made good use of them.

"Oh, Marilla, what do you think? You know tomorrow is Diana's birthday. Well, her mother told her she could ask me to go home with her from school and stay all night with her. And her cousins are coming over from Newbridge in a big pung sleigh to go to the Debating Club concert at the hall tomorrow night. And they are going to take Diana and me to the concert-if you'll let me go, that is. You will, won't you, Marilla? Oh, I feel so excited."

"You can calm down then, because you're not going. You're better at home in your own bed, and as for that club concert, it's all nonsense, and little girls should not be allowed to go out to such places at all."

"I'm sure the Debating Club is a most respectable affair," pleaded Anne.

"I'm not saying it isn't. But you're not going to begin gadding about to concerts and staying out all hours of the night. Pretty doings for children. I'm surprised at Mrs. Barry's letting Diana go."

"But it's such a very special occasion," mourned Anne, on the verge of tears. "Diana has only one birthday in a year. It isn't as if birthdays were common things, Marilla. Prissy Andrews is going to recite 'Curfew Must Not Ring Tonight.' That is such a good moral piece, Marilla, I'm sure it would do me lots of good to hear it. And the choir are going to sing four lovely pathetic songs that are pretty near as good as hymns. And oh, Marilla, the minister is going to take part; yes, indeed, he is; he's going to give an address. That will be just about the same thing as a sermon. Please, mayn't I go, Marilla?"

"You heard what I said, Anne, didn't you? Take off your boots now and go to bed. It's past eight."

From this interaction between Anne and Marilla, we can infer that Anne is an imaginative and eager girl who loves spending time with her friend Diana. She is creative enough to come up with a signaling system using candles and cardboard. Marilla, on the other hand, is strict and concerned about Anne's safety, since she does not allow her to go to the Debating Club concert at night. Marilla believes it is not appropriate for young girls to be out late, and that Anne should stay in bed and rest. This interaction gives us insight into their personalities, as well as the relationship between them—Marilla as the guardian, and Anne as the wild, spirited child.
